    Jan Michael "Mike" Sikes, age 70 and a resident of Washington, died Sunday, April 17, 2022 at his home after a brave but brief battle with aggressive lung cancer.

    On October 31, 2005 at Duke Medical Center, he received the most precious gift that anyone could receive, a heart transplant. Thanks to God for allowing us almost 17 extra years. He got to see and enjoy his three wonderful grandchildren, whom he loved dearly.

    The family will receive friends from 6:00 pm until 8:00 pm on Wednesday, April 20, 2022 at Joseph B. Paul Jr. Funeral Service in Washington and other times at the home in Washington. Funeral service will be held Thursday, April 21 at 11:00 am at Joseph B. Paul Jr. Funeral Service, conducted by Rev. Kevin Woolard. Burial will follow at Oakdale Cemetery. Noel Lee, Brian Dixon Sr., Tony Hoell, Bill Dawson, Anthony Bailey, Tandy Dunn, Jeremy Wallace and Shaun Carroll will serve as pallbearers. Members of the Clark's Neck Volunteer Fire Dept. will serve as honorary pallbearers.

    Mike was born in Whiteville, NC on January 17, 1952. He was the son of the late Raymond Sikes and Hazel Sikes Sessoms.

    Mike worked as an electrician for over 25 years with National Spinning as long as his health permitted.

    Mike was a member of Clark's Neck Volunteer Fire Department for 33 years. He received Fireman of the Year in 1992 and 2000. He also received Beaufort County Fireman of the Year in 1992. He was on the Board of Directors at CNFD. He loved his fire department. He was an assistant coach in the Little Tarheel League, Junior Babe Ruth, and Washington girls' softball.

    On December 1, 1972, he married the former Betty Lou Asby of Aurora.

    Survivors include his devoted wife Betty of nearly 50 years at the home, children Brad Sikes and wife Mary Ruth Sikes of Winterville, Gina Woolard and husband Brad Woolard of Chocowinity. He is also survived by grandchildren Trent Woolard of Charlotte and both Davis and Mary Grace Sikes of Winterville. They dearly loved their "Papa".

    Surviving siblings include his brother Jerry Sikes of Supply, NC; sisters Barbara Sikes of Bolton, NC and Sue Patterson of Sanford, NC; and sister-in-law Susan Sikes of Louisburg NC.
